We are an AAHA-accredited veterinary hospital. Only 12-15% (about 3,600) of hospitals have gone through the accreditation evaluation process by the American Animal Hospital Association. Accreditation by AAHA means we have been evaluated on approximately 900 standards of veterinary excellence. That means we hold ourselves to a higher standard. Pets are our passion.
